Patent number: 9098708Abstract: The security or other attributes of mobile applications may be assessed and assigned a security score. In one implementation, a device may obtain information relating to the mobile applications, and may determine, for each of the mobile applications, a number of security scores. Each of the security scores may define a level of risk for a security category relating to a mobile application. The device may further combine the security scores, for each of the mobile applications, to obtain, for each of the mobile applications, a final security score.Type: GrantFiled: June 6, 2014Date of Patent: August 4, 2015Assignee: Verizon Patent and Licensing Inc.Inventors: Steven T. Patent number: 9100415Abstract: A device in a provider network receives a Session Initiation Protocol (SIP) request message from an originating device, where the SIP request message includes a general number for a voicemail service and where the voicemail service includes multiple voicemail systems. The device determines whether the originating device is associated with a voice-over-Internet-protocol (VoIP) account on the provider network and, when the originating device is associated with a VoIP account, selects a direct access number assigned to a voicemail system, from the multiple voicemail systems in the network, that services the VoIP account. The device also associates the direct access number and the SIP request message, and forwards, based on the direct access number, the SIP request message to an application server.Type: GrantFiled: December 17, 2009Date of Patent: August 4, 2015Assignee: Verizon Patent and Licensing Inc.Inventors: Michelle Madden Johnston, Euclid S. Patent number: 9100299Abstract: A method includes generating, by a first network device, test traffic to be transmitted to a second network device. The first and second network devices are coupled via a number of communication links, where one of links is a backup link. The method also includes transmitting, by the first network device, the test traffic to the second network device at periodic intervals via the backup link, receiving, by the second network device, the test traffic and monitoring the received test traffic. The method further includes comparing the monitored test traffic to a threshold, determining whether the monitored test traffic meets the threshold, and generating an alarm or notification message, in response to determining that the monitored test traffic does not meet the threshold.Type: GrantFiled: May 21, 2012Date of Patent: August 4, 2015Assignee: Verizon Patent and Licensing Inc.Inventors: Roman Krzanowski, Frank M. Patent number: 9100432Abstract: A method, performed by a computer device, may include receiving an indication of a distributed denial of service event at a front end system associated with a customer; generating one or more virtual front end systems for the customer, in response to receiving the indication of the distributed denial of service event; and redirecting traffic intended for the customer's front end system to the generated one or more virtual front end systems. The method may further include determining whether resource capacity of the generated one or more virtual front end systems has been reached; and generating an additional one or more virtual front end systems for the customer, in response to determining that the resource capacity of the generated one or more virtual front end systems has been reached.Type: GrantFiled: December 21, 2012Date of Patent: August 4, 2015Assignee: Verizon Patent and Licensing Inc.Inventors: Mark D. Publication number: 20150215130Abstract: A security device may receive a request, associated with a user, to access a particular device. The security device may authenticate the user based on the request. The security device may determine a key, from a set of keys stored by the security device, that is unassigned, and may assign the key to the user. The security device may mark the key as assigned. The security device may provide the key to the particular device, which may cause the particular device to validate the key by comparing the key to a set of valid keys. The set of valid keys may be stored in a memory accessible by the particular device based on having been previously provided to the particular device by the security device. The security device may establish a session with the particular device, and may provide the user with access to the particular device via the session.Type: ApplicationFiled: January 30, 2014Publication date: July 30, 2015Applicant: Verizon Patent and Licensing Inc.Inventors: Timothy BROPHY, Paul M. Publication number: 20150215346Abstract: One or more devices are provided that receive a request, from a client device, to connect to an operator network. The request is received at a request time. The one or more devices obtain information identifying a connect time at which the client device is permitted to connect to the operator network and determine whether the request time matches the connect time. If the request time is determined to be different than the connect time, the one or more devices reject the request to connect to the operator network based on the request time being determined to be different than the connect time. If the request time is determined to match the connect time, the one or more devices establish a communication session between the client device and the operator network based on the request time being determined to match the connect time.Type: ApplicationFiled: January 27, 2014Publication date: July 30, 2015Applicants: Cellco Partnership d/b/a Verizon Wireless, Verizon Patent and Licensing Inc.Inventors: Lalit R. Patent number: 9092791Abstract: A method and system of provisioning resources installed in a network element. Resources are installed in the network element. As resources are placed into service, a notification is transmitted to the vendor. The vendor generates an invoice, and the service provider generates a purchase order. Furthermore, a capacity planning system may monitor the system as resources are placed into service. If the amount of spare resources fall below a predetermined limit, the capacity planning system may transmit a request to the vendor for the additional equipment. In this manner, resources may be installed prior to the actual need for the resources. The resources may then be paid for by the service provider as the resources are needed and placed into service, thereby enabling a risk-sharing arrangement between the service provider and the vendor.Type: GrantFiled: June 16, 2011Date of Patent: July 28, 2015Assignee: Verizon Patent and Licensing Inc.Inventors: Ronald D.
